The 33m/108'3" motor yacht 'Exit Strategy' (ex. Marsha Kay) was built by Broward in the United States at their Fort Lauderdale, Florida shipyard. Her interior is styled by design house Dee Robinson Interiors and she was completed in 1995. This luxury vessel's exterior design is the work of Broward and she was last refitted in 2018.
Exit Strategy has been designed to comfortably accommodate up to 8 guests in 4 suites comprising one VIP cabin. She is also capable of carrying up to 3 crew onboard to ensure a relaxed luxury yacht experience.
Her features include satellite communications, WiFi and air conditioning.
Built with a aluminium hull and aluminium superstructure, with grp & teak decks, she benefits from a semi-displacement hull to provide exceptional seakeeping and impressive speeds. Powered by twin diesel Detroit Diesel (16V- 92TA) 16-cylinder 1,450hp engines, she comfortably cruises at 14 knots, reaches a maximum speed of 25 knots with a range of up to 2,000 nautical miles from her 32,930 litre fuel tanks. An on board stabilization system ensures comfort when underway. Her water tanks store around 8,705 Litres of fresh water. She was built to ABS (American Bureau of Shipping) classification society rules.
